Find shortest path using Floyd-Warshall algorithm
Description
This is a fast implementation of Floyd-Warshall algorithm to find the shortest path in a pairwise sense using 'RcppArmadillo'. A logical input is also accepted.

Examples
## generate a toy data
X = aux.gensamples(n=10)
## Find knn graph with k=5
Xgraph = aux.graphnbd(X,type=c("knn",5))
## Separately use binarized and real distance matrices
W1 = aux.shortestpath(Xgraph$mask)
W2 = aux.shortestpath(Xgraph$dist)
## visualize
opar <- par(no.readonly=TRUE)
par(mfrow=c(1,2), pty="s")
image(W1, main="from binarized")
image(W2, main="from Euclidean distance")
par(opar)
